Quotes (also called estimates) let you turn a lead or job into a priced proposal your customer can review, approve, and e-sign. You build the quote from your products and pricing catalog, customize the line items and totals, then send it by text or email straight from Revenue Sol.

Before you start

Quotes work best when your catalog is ready to go. Add your services and materials to the products and pricing catalog first so you can drop them into a quote as line items instead of typing everything by hand each time.
Connect a contact or lead to the quote so it stays attached to that customer’s record. That way the quote, the conversation, and any resulting job all live in one place.

Build a quote

1

Start a new quote

Open the Quotes area and create a new quote, then attach it to the customer (a contact or lead). You can also start a quote directly from a lead or job record so the customer details carry over automatically.
2

Add line items from your catalog

Add line items by selecting services or products from your catalog. Each item pulls in its name, description, and price, so you only adjust the quantity. You can also add a one-off custom line item for anything not in your catalog.
3

Set quantities and adjust pricing

Update quantities for each line, and edit the price or description on any line if this job needs something different from the catalog default. Apply discounts where appropriate.
4

Review totals and taxes

Revenue Sol calculates the subtotal automatically as you add lines. Apply the tax rate so the customer sees the correct total before they approve.
5

Customize the quote

Add notes, terms, or a personal message so the customer understands what’s included. Review everything once more before sending.

Totals and taxes

As you add and edit line items, the subtotal updates in real time. Add any tax and discounts so the displayed total matches what the customer will actually pay. Always confirm the final number is correct before you send, since this is the amount the customer approves and e-signs.
A quote is a proposal, not a charge. Nothing is billed when you send it. After the customer approves, you convert it into an invoice to collect payment. See Invoices and Getting paid.

Send by text or email

When the quote is ready, send it to your customer by text message or email. The customer receives a link to view the full quote, where they can approve and e-sign it. Sending by text usually gets the fastest response for local home-service work, while email is useful for larger or more detailed proposals.
1

Choose how to send

Pick text or email. Make sure the customer’s mobile number or email address is on their contact record.
2

Send the quote

Send it, and the customer gets a link to review the quote online.
3

Track the response

Watch the quote status to see when the customer views, approves, or declines it. Approved quotes can be turned into a job and an invoice.
Text-to-send relies on your connected Twilio or RingCentral number. Make sure your number is connected before sending quotes by text. Carrier message costs are billed at cost with no markup.
